The story centers on Jonas, young man who lives in a supposedly ideal world of conformity and contentment. Yet as he begins to spend time with the elder, who is the sole keeper of all the community's memories, Jonas quickly begins to discover the dark and deadly truths of his community's secret past. At extreme odds, Jonas knows that he must escape their world to protect them all; a challenge that no one has ever succeeded at before.

The Bastable children have been banished to the country in disgrace, following a particularly damaging re-enaction of a jungle scene featuring expensive stuffed animals and a garden hose. Dora, Oswald, Dicky, Alice, Noel and Horace Octavius (H.O.), decide to turn over a new leaf. Spurred on by Dora's urgings, the children found 'The Society of the Wouldbegoods' aiming to mend their ways by being good whenever possible. But the schemes they undertake...
